
David Hough (13 March 1753 – 18 April 1831) was a member of the US House of Representatives (F-NH 4) from 4 March 1803 to 3 March 1805 (succeeding Abiel Foster and preceding Samuel Tenney) and from NH-3 from 4 March 1805 to 3 March 1807 (succeeding Tenney and preceding Francis Gardner.
Biography[]
David Hough was born in Norwich, New London County, Connecticut in 1753, and he moved to Lebanon, Grafton County, New Hampshire in 1778. He served in the State House from 1788 to 1789 and in 1794 and in the US House of Representatives from 1803 to 1805, and he died in 1831.
